Output 823d1b6956367a8292003419ddf95b499832127dc8edb44ef9c8272e58eb8986:3

value
288054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 090cec07308d79e3fad69206ffbb83d36215e3e9 OP_EQUAL
address
32WsV7539iAPctsSVJf2aUD86SsV76kXtp
transaction
823d1b6956367a8292003419ddf95b499832127dc8edb44ef9c8272e58eb8986
spent
true